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[MySQL][PHP] Nie dziala mysql_select_db, Nie mogę nawiązać połączenia z bazą danych
Fakebook
post
Post #1





Grupa: Zarejestrowani
Postów: 18
Pomógł: 0
Dołączył: 18.03.2014

Ostrzeżenie: (0%)
-----


Witam

Dopiero zaczynam przygodę z php, uczę się bazując na darmowych tutorialach z internetu. Ugrzązłem jednak z mysqlem.

W tutorialu utworzylismy baze danych 'database', oraz uzytkownika 'name' i hasle 'password'. Mam wykupiony hosting wiec pracuje na zywym organizmie.

Kod wyglada nastepująco:

$conn_error = 'Could not connect.';

$mysql_host = 'localhost';
$mysql_user = 'name';
$mysql_pass = 'password';

$mysql_db = 'database';

$link = mysqli_connect($mysql_host, $mysql_user,$mysql_pass) or die($conn_error.'1');

mysql_select_db('a_database') or die($conn_error.'2');

echo 'Connected!';


Gdy odpalam wyswietla sie jedynie error z cyfra '2', czyli cos poszlo nie tak z komenda mysql_select_db. Nie mam zielonego pojęcia dlaczego nie moge nawiazac połączenia z bazą danych, czy ma ktoś pomysł co mogło pójść nie tak?

Pozdrawiam!
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
YourFrog
post
Post #2





Grupa: Zarejestrowani
Postów: 124
Pomógł: 22
Dołączył: 10.01.2014

Ostrzeżenie: (0%)
-----


Ja tylko dodam że skoro i tak już uczysz się nowej biblioteki to lepiej weź pod uwagę PDO. Całkowicie inny sposób podejścia do problemu jednak daje dużo większą elastyczność pracy. Ewentualnie jakiegoś ORM'a (Doctrine, Propel).
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 12.10.2025 - 07:31